Summary

A historical study of the treatment of Jews in Yugoslavia after Nazi ideology was adopted, with an emphasis on the ways Jews survived and were rescued by those who put their own lives in great peril. When Courage Prevailedexamines the ways Jews were rescued and survived in a country which the Ustase, with their roots in Yugoslavia's nationality conflicts and politics, adopted the Nazi ideology which emphasized that there could be no compromise in regard to the Jewish Question and the Final Solution: no Jews deserved rescue. Survival of Jews was complicated by Yugoslavia's dismemberment at the hands of the Axis Powers; Germany and Italy and its satellites and puppets. The Nazi propaganda machine advocated that Jews must be exterminated for the good of the Aryans which included the Volksdeutsche, (Yugoslav of German ancestry), the Croats and the Muslims. Those who dared to defy German commands suffered severe penalties.

Author Biography

Esther Gitman pursued her Ph.D. in Jewish Studies on the foundation of a successful business career. She sought to Understand the circumstances of the rescue and survival, including her own, of Jews from the Nazis and Ustae (Croatian fascists). Gitman returned to Sarajevo in. 1945 and then moved to Israel in 1948. After the Six-Day War in 1967 she and her husband relocated to Canada. Since 1972 Gitman has lived in the United States.
